Weird Phobias-1

Most people suffer from one sort of phobia or another.  It’s not uncommon.  In fact, a person without a phobia is probably in the minority.  For example, a lot of people have a fear of heights. They have acrophobia.  Children often need a nightlight, because they have a very real fear of the bogeyman. Although most kids will grown out of it, by the time they are adolescents, bogyphobia can be debilitating, and make it almost impossible to go to sleep every night.  But, there are some phobias that are simply weird!  For example:

The Fear of Colors

If you are a fan of the television series Numb3rs, then you know that one of the professors prefers to only eat white food.  He doesn’t really explain this preference.  He is not afraid of other colors.  Maybe, he just thinks that white foods are healthier because of the absence of food coloring.  Who knows?

But, there are people in real life that have a fear of certain colors or fear of colors in general.  Chromatophobia is fear of colors.  But, there are phobic names specific to certain colors. If you had a fear of the color blue, it wouldn’t be too difficult to make sure that there was nothing blue in your house.  But, how could you go outside or to the grocery store?

Unhealthy Fears

In general, all unrealistic fears are unhealthy. But, there are some fears that can lead to poor health, and make it very difficult to coexist with family members. For instance, some people have a very real fear of taking a bath. Imagine how difficult it would be to live with someone who suffers from ablutophobia. Disregarding the odoriferous emanations, it would eventually cause a variety of serious health concerns.

Geumaphobia is the fear of taste. Think of your favorite food.  Now try to imagine not wanting to taste it.  It seems like it would be impossible to eat anything, even if you plugged your nose.  If therapy couldn’t relieve this fear, I suppose an ear; nose and throat surgeon could disable the olfactory nerve, so everything has no real taste.

Even if a phobic could make it through a terrifying shower, or manage to choke down some food, without tasting it, what happens if he/she is truly hypnophobic?  No matter how tired, just the idea of going to sleep is a nightmare.

However, for people with aerophobia, it would be almost impossible to breathe.  They have a fear of swallowing air.
